Among various conditions, *lipemia* stands out—it’s that term you’ll often come across in lab context, and it refers to a specimen with elevated levels of fatty substances, specifically triglycerides or lipids.

    So, what's the big deal about lipemic samples? Well, let me explain: when a serum or plasma specimen becomes lipemic, it can develop a cloudy or turbid appearance — picture thick, milky fluid. This isn’t just about aesthetics; it can interfere with certain laboratory tests, leading to inaccurate results. You certainly don't want a test skewed because of a milky specimen! 

    On top of that, lipemia can arise from various sources — dietary choices, metabolic disorders, or certain diseases might all come into play. Perhaps someone indulged in a rich meal before their blood test; that indulgence can show up in their results! And that’s crucial when considering how to accurately evaluate their health. 

    Now, it’s time we contrast lipemic with similar terms that might crop up in discussions. For instance, let’s take *hemolytic*. Have you noticed when some samples appear red or pink? That’s often due to hemolysis or the breakdown of red blood cells. While this might look alarming, it's separate from the fatty issues we see with lipemia. 

    Or think about the term *serous*, which describes a clear, pale yellow fluid typically found in serum. It sounds similar and might even confuse folks preparing for their exams, but it doesn’t carry any of the lipid-associated implications of lipemia. 

    You might encounter *chylous* as well—this refers to a specific type of fluid characterized by chyle, which is a milky substance made of lymph and fats. This fluid doesn’t really belong in the serum or plasma discussion since it's more related to the lymphatic system.
